QUESTION: I live in Saudi Arabia and plan to start a visa business. For example, a friend sells a visa for 2000 SAR, and I resell it for 3000 SAR. Both the friend and the buyer know I’m making a profit. Is this profit halal?

QUESTION: I live in Saudi Arabia and plan to start a visa business. For example, a friend sells a visa for 2000 SAR, and I resell it for 3000 SAR. Both the friend and the buyer know I’m making a profit. Is this profit halal?

25 May

ANSWER:

This is illegal and it is haram money
